Is this Severe Vent Gleet or Infection

So I just extracted this syringe full just to see if it is water belly. The liquid that came out is super clear and when I 1st poked the needle in (didn't go in far at all) blood came out....so the liquid that came out since its clear & not yellowish is it not water belly? I attached a pic
It's water belly. The fluid ranges in color from clear to yellow to amber. (The bit of blood is probably from hitting a blood vessel in the skin.) A good avian vet might be able to pinpoint the cause of the fluid buildup (liver, heart, reproductive issue, etc), but if that;s not an option I'd just try to keep the fluid from building up too much. Be careful of draining too much as it can be a shock to the bird and the less fluid in her belly the less buffer there is between your needle and her organs. Just try to keep her comfortable and mobile. It also might be a good idea to order some antibiotics to have on hand as infection can become a problem. My vet used to give clavamox to prevent infection when she drained my girl with ascites. Fish-mox/aqua-mox is the same drug and can ordered online or found in some pet stores.
